Washington State Ferries (WSF) is revolutionizing the ferry transportation industry in the United States. With a commitment to sustainability and reducing emissions, WSF is at the forefront of electrification efforts. By embracing this technology, they are paving the way for a cleaner and greener future.

With the largest ferry system in the country, WSF has taken the initiative to explore and implement electric propulsion systems. This bold move not only sets an example for other ferry systems but also showcases the potential of electrification in the maritime sector.

What are the benefits of ferry electrification?

Ferry electrification brings several benefits, including reduced emissions, lower noise pollution, and improved passenger experience. It also contributes to a more sustainable and environmentally-friendly transportation industry.

Are electric ferries as reliable as traditional ferries?

Yes, electric ferries are just as reliable as traditional ferries. With advancements in technology and continuous improvements, electric propulsion systems have proven to be efficient and dependable, providing a seamless and safe ferry experience.

What challenges are involved in ferry electrification?

Ferry electrification comes with its own set of challenges, including the development of adequate charging infrastructure, optimizing vessel design for electric propulsion, and ensuring sufficient battery storage capacity. However, through collaboration and innovation, these challenges are being overcome to achieve successful electrification.
